Definition
  1. Noun:
    • A historical institution for child care: "Bảo anh viện" refers to an orphanage or a charitable institution, typically established in the past, that provided care and shelter for orphaned, abandoned, or needy children.
Usage Examples
  • Noun:
    • Trong quá khứ, nhiều trẻ em mồ côi được nuôi dưỡng tại các bảo anh viện. (In the past, many orphaned children were raised in orphanages.)
    • Bảo anh viện này được thành lập từ thế kỷ 19. (This orphanage was established in the 19th century.)
Advanced Usage
  • This term is considered archaic in modern Vietnamese. It is primarily found in historical texts, literature, or when referring to institutions from the feudal or colonial periods. The contemporary equivalent is "trại trẻ mồ côi" or "viện mồ côi".
Variants and Related Words
  • Trại trẻ mồ côi (n): Modern term for orphanage.
  • Viện mồ côi (n): Alternative modern term for orphanage.
  • Nhà trẻ (n): Nursery or daycare center (for general childcare, not specifically for orphans).
  • Trung tâm bảo trợ xã hội (n): Social protection center (a broader term that may include care for children).
Synonyms
  • Cô nhi viện (n): Another historical/formal term for orphanage.
  • Nhà nuôi trẻ (n): Children's home.
Notes on Meaning
  • The term "bảo anh viện" is a compound noun. Its literal components are "bảo" (to protect), "anh" (a respectful term for children, or "infant"), and "viện" (institute). Therefore, it directly translates to "institute for protecting children."
  • It specifically denotes a charitable or public institution, not informal or family-based care.
